The 4 classifications are:- 1 Acute angle which is greater than 0 but less than 90 degrees 2 Right angle which is 90 degrees 3 Obtuse angle which is greater than 90 but less than 180 degrees 4 Reflex angle which is greater than 180 but less than 360 degrees A full rotation is 360 degrees

The sine of an angle between 0 and 180 degrees is positive. The sine of an angle between 180 degrees and 360 degrees is negative. At 0, 180 and 360 degrees the sine is 0.The sine is a periodic function with period 360 degrees, so angles differing by a multitude of 360 degrees have the same sine. Hence, for instance, the sines of the angles 0, 360, 720, ... are equal, namely 0.In any right triangle the sine of one of the non-right angles will be positive, since these are greater than 0 and less than 90 degrees.

The sine of an angle x is defined as the ratio of the opposing side to the hypotenuse, in a right triangle having x as one of its acute angles. If it was greater than 1, it would mean the opposing side was longer than the hypotenuse. Try to draw a right triangle with one of the sides longer than the diagonal. You'll notice it's impossible. So the sine cannot be greater than 1. Fitting the triangle into a circle of radius 1, such that the angle x is located at the origin and the hypotenuse is a radius of the circle, you can define "sine of x" for any angle. Since the triangle may end up flipped in any direction, including the negative x and y axis, it turns out that the sine of any number is between -1 and +1. The cosine is simply the sine of the complementary angle (90 - x). So it must also be contained between -1 and +1.
